Miss Jamaica Gabrielle Henry Recovering Well After Dramatic Fall at Miss Universe 2025
Miss Universe Jamaica Gabrielle Henry is on the mend after falling off stage during preliminary rounds in Bangkok.
Miss Jamaica 2025, Gabrielle Henry, is recovering after a frightening fall during the Miss Universe preliminary evening gown round held at Bangkok’s Impact Arena on November 19, 2025. The 28-year-old ophthalmologist and beauty queen slipped off the edge of the stage during her walk, leading to her being rushed to Paolo Rangsit Hospital for medical evaluation. Videos of the fall quickly spread on social media, causing concern among fans worldwide.
Raul Rocha, Miss Universe Organization president, provided an official health update, stating that he personally assisted Gabrielle immediately after the fall and oversaw the rapid coordination of medical care. He confirmed that Gabrielle suffered no fractures or life-threatening injuries but was kept under observation and underwent extensive tests by multiple specialists to ensure her full recovery. The organization has taken responsibility for all medical and related expenses, including those of her accompanying family members.
Following several days under medical supervision, the latest reports indicate Gabrielle Henry is in good health and close to being discharged from the hospital. The organization reaffirmed their commitment to respecting her privacy while focusing on a smooth recovery path. Despite missing the final competition rounds, Gabrielle has received an outpouring of messages of support and well wishes from fans and fellow contestants alike.
